Anti-inflammatory effect of Lactobacillus casei on Shigella-infected human intestinal epithelial cells.

Shigella invades the human intestinal mucosa, thus causing bacillary dysentery, an acute recto-colitis responsible for lethal complications, mostly in infants and toddlers. Conversely, commensal bacteria live in a mutualistic relationship with the intestinal mucosa that is characterized by homeostatic control of innate responses, thereby contributing to tolerance to the flora. P163: The Anti-Inflammatory Effects of Human Amniotic Membrane Epithelial Cells-Derived Condition Media

The human amniotic membrane known as the innermost single epithelial-covered layer provides many applications such as applicable anti-inflammatory and anti-cancer effects. These immunomodulatory effects belongs to the epithelial cells, a type of epiblast-derived fetal stem cells which currently used for regenerative medicine and transplantation.
